SCOC: a Sediment Community Oxygen Consumption (SCOC) dataset

Description Usage Format Author(s) References See Also Examples

Description

This literature dataset, compiled by Andersson et al. (2004) contains 584 measurements of sediment community oxygen consumption rates, as a function of water depth, and performed in deep-water sediments, either by in situ incubations or via modelling of oxygen microprofiles.

Format

a dataframe with 584 rows, and with following columns:

Depth.m, the water depth at which the measurement was performed.

SCOC.mmol/m2/d, the oxygen consumption rate of the sediment, [mmolO2/m2/d]

References

Andersson, H., Wijsman, J., Herman, P., Middelburg, J., Soetaert, K., Heip, C., 2004. Respiration patterns in the deep ocean. Geophysical Research Letters 31, LO3304.

plot(SCOC[,1],SCOC[,2],log="xy",xlab="water depth, m",ylab="" ,
     main="SCOC, mmol O2/m2/d",pch=16,xaxt="n",yaxt="n",cex.main=1)

axis(1,at=c(0.5,5,50,500,5000),labels=c("0.5","5","50","500","5000"))
axis(2,at=c(0.1,1,10,100),labels=c("0.1","1","10","100"))

ll <- lm(log(SCOC[,2])~ log(SCOC[,1]))
rr <- summary(ll)$r.squared
A  <- exp(coef(ll)[1])
B  <- (coef(ll)[2])
curve(A*x^B,add=TRUE,lwd=2)
AA <- round(A*100)/100
BB <- round(B*100)/100
expr <- substitute(y==A*x^B,list(A=AA,B=BB))
text(1,.1,expr,adj=0)
expr2 <- substitute(r^2==rr,list(rr=round(rr*100)/100))
text(1,0.04,expr2, adj=0)
